The details

This automatic watch trades round edges for octagonal geometry and pairs the case with a bracelet that flows into it as one continuous piece. The dial carries a machined V pattern that reflects and refracts light as you move, creating visual depth that shifts throughout the day. A Citizen Miyota Series 9120 movement powers the timekeeping, winding itself from the motion of your wrist and holding a forty-hour reserve when you set it down.

The 41mm case is made from 316L stainless steel with a thickness of 13.5mm, and the bracelet matches with alternating brushed and polished links in an H-shaped pattern. A double-domed sapphire crystal protects the face, offering scratch resistance and optical clarity, while the caseback window displays the movement at work. Swiss Super-LumiNova ensures legibility in low light, and the folding clasp with push buttons keeps the bracelet secure.

At 10 ATM water resistance—100 meters—you can wear it through rain, handwashing, and swimming without concern. Questions

Does this watch need a battery?
No. The Citizen Miyota automatic movement winds itself from the motion of your wrist as you wear it. When fully wound, it holds a forty-hour power reserve, so it will keep running through a day off if you've worn it recently. If it stops, a few shakes or wearing it for a few minutes will start it again.
Can I swim with this watch?
Yes. With 10 ATM water resistance (100 meters), it's suitable for swimming, snorkeling, and everyday water exposure like showers or handwashing. Avoid operating the buttons or crown underwater, and keep it away from hot water or steam, which can affect the seals.
How do I adjust the bracelet length?
The steel bracelet has removable links held by pins or screws. You'll need a watch tool or can have a jeweler adjust it. The folding clasp also includes micro-adjustment holes for fine-tuning the fit without removing full links.
What makes the dial pattern shift in light?
The V-shaped pattern is machined into the dial, creating facets that catch and reflect light at different angles. As you move your wrist or change your viewing angle, the pattern's appearance shifts, adding depth and visual interest to the face.
Is the sapphire crystal glass scratch-proof?
Sapphire crystal is highly scratch-resistant and will hold up to daily wear better than mineral glass or acrylic. It can still be scratched by materials harder than sapphire, such as diamond or certain ceramics, but normal use won't mark it.
Can I see the movement through the back?
Yes. The watch has a sapphire exhibition caseback that lets you see the Citizen Miyota automatic movement in action. You'll see the rotor spinning as the watch winds itself and the gears turning as it keeps time.
